Costs typically range from an average of $3-$6 per square foot of flooring. The cost to do mine (Wilmington, NC) was: Sand, stain, and finish (water-based) – $4.75 per square foot of flooring x 635 sf = $3016.25. Sanding hardwood floors for refinishing involves numerous steps. The sanders start with a more aggressive grit sandpaper to remove the current finish and debris, then they make several additional cuts with the sanders at higher grits to produce a smooth, even surface. When using ...Buffing is done like this: down on hands and knees, hand sand the edges of the floor with fine sand paper. I generally use 120 grit. Then the floor area is polished with polisher and a screen mesh disc. Depending on the finish one will use anywhere from 220 grit to more coarse 180 or 150 grit. The cost for hardwood floor refinishing generally falls into the range of $3 ...It is standard for companies to take 2-6 days to refinish hardwood floors. It will take 6-12 days before you can move your furniture back into the house once the floor is refinished. The exact time varies based on floor size, sanding duration, and drying time between multiple coats of finish.When to Refinish Hardwood Floors. Safety Considerations. Engineered hardwood floors that can generally be refinished include the following. First, any engineered hardwoods with a remaining wear layer of 3mm or thicker can safely be refinished at least once. Second, any engineered hardwoods that have guidance from the manufacturer in …When new, a solid hardwood plank is typically at least 3/4 inches thick and can likely be refinished at least four to six times during its total lifespan. We can provide a wide variety of services, some of which include: Installing distressed hardwood floors.Feb 22, 2024 · Sand the Floor. Install a 40- or 60-grit sanding belt on an upright drum sander. While wearing protective gear (eye, hearing, breathing), sand the entire floor, moving parallel to the direction of the boards—not across the wood grain. After about 20 years, most hardwood floors start showing their age; scratches, dullness and discoloring are the most common signs that the wood is due for refinishing. Fortunately, the typical ¾-inch-thick hardwood floor can be sanded about six to eight times during its lifetime. Work the drum sander back and forth over 3- to 4-foot lengths. Use overlapping strokes by at least 1/3 the belt width to remove scratches. Start with coarse sandpaper of 36 to 40 grit, progress to a medium 60-grit paper and finish with a finer 100 grit. Do not skip the progression from coarse grades to finer grades.
